Is there a tailors kit for metal objects? Or is my firemans helmet cursed forever to remain un-kevlarfied and un-leatherfied?
Soldering iron.
That only allows you to reinforce objects, there be a difference.

Tailor kits allow you to take clothing customization to the next level, allowing stuff like reinforcing with kevlar or leather, or extra volume or warmth, and a reinforced piece of clothing lined with kevlar and padded with leather is one tough thing to break.

It's probably a design oversight since tailor kits can be used on other soldering iron applied materials.

RE: Fungal Zombies
Melee is a perfectly valid approach (other than the fungal towers themselves) so long as you have enough environmental protection on your mouth.
Used to be a Filter Mask was enough, but I think it's been changed, and you may need a Gas Mask or better now.
As long as you account for the extra encumbrance on the mouth (can't remember exactly what the penalties were, but they were relevant to melee at least) then there's no reason you can't become a mushroom-kicking badass.
